Economic balancing of forest management under storm risk, the case of the Ore Mountains (Germany)
Peter Deegen and
Kai Matolepszy
Journal of Forest Economics, 2015, vol. 21, issue 1, 1-13
Abstract:
Storm events shorten the optimal rotation compared with the classical Faustmann solution.
